Make Sublime Text the default AXD viewer

Setting a default program by file type in Windows

  1. Right-click on your AXD file, then choose the "Open with" option and select "Choose another application" from the available options;
  2. Inside the popup window, scroll through the list of applications and specifically choose Sublime Text as the application to associate with your AXD file;
  3. Check the "Always use this app" checkbox and click "OK".

Change the default app to open files on Mac

  1. Right click or use Control + Left Click on the desired AXD file to access a dropdown menu of actions;
  2. Select "Open in application" and click "Other";
  3. Next, at the bottom of the window, you will see the "Enable" menu, in which "Recommended Programs" is selected by default;
  4. In this menu, select "All Programs", then find Sublime Text and check the box next to "Always open in the application."
